In batik technique melted wax is used as a resist so that the colour doesn't bleed on the fabric. Basically I do the drawing with wax and then I paint using the dyes. Or the dyeing can be done is several stages. When the wax is removed some beautiful effects comes up. It is difficult to travel and carry all the material, but it can be done.

To reply to some of your comments , I have been travelling in warm countryies (I live in Scotland, and I have enough of cold weather at home), so I don't need heavy clothes. I bring with me only one book, which I read and then exchange with another one. Half of my rocksuck is filled with batik material. In new zealand I travelled on a campervan, and all camping sites have generally an plug in point, as the wax pot needs electricity.
